Crno Jezero, commonly known as Black Lake, is a breathtaking reservoir located in the heart of Montenegro, nestled within the Durmitor National Park. This stunning natural wonder captivates visitors with its crystal-clear waters, which reflect the surrounding peaks of the Dinaric Alps. The lake is framed by lush green forests and rugged mountain terrain, creating a picturesque setting perfect for photography and relaxation. Nature enthusiasts will find numerous hiking trails around the lake, with a popular 4-kilometer loop that takes approximately 1 hour and 15 minutes to complete. The trails offer varying levels of difficulty, catering to both casual walkers and seasoned hikers. As you stroll along the path, take in the fresh air and the soothing sounds of nature, making it a perfect escape from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. For those seeking a more leisurely experience, renting a small boat to paddle across the lake is a delightful way to enjoy the scenery from a different perspective. The area is also home to diverse wildlife, so keep an eye out for the various bird species and other creatures that inhabit this beautiful region.
